Kittery - The Maine and New Hampshire Departments of Transportation will be initiating the closure of one northbound and one southbound through lane on the I-95 Piscataqua River Bridge between Portsmouth, NH and Kittery, ME beginning Thursday morning, April 27th.
The set-up for the closure is scheduled to begin on Wednesday evening, April 26th.
During this lane closure, an inspection of truss members will be conducted as well as other inspection and annual maintenance efforts.
The lane closures will also serve as a test for traffic control during the upcoming bridge rehabilitation efforts that will begin in 2018. Travelers are advised to consider alternate routes or allow additional time to travel.
The Departments asks that all motorists be patient, reduce speed, and exercise added caution when traveling near and throughout this work zone.
The closed lanes will reopen Monday evening, May 1st.
